Originally Posted by Speed_Force_E60' post='946822' date='Jul 19 2009, 06:13 PM
So John, did you really need the spacers? or does it sit flush? Monsterj34 is rubbing and he aint usin no spacers..
Im planning to put 5mm spacers in front and dumping the car a little more to make the tires tuck.

He rubs because he is using 245/35/20, 275/30/20 tires and lowered on H&R springs. To help with the rubbing, he can rolled the fenders or get lower profile tires.

I am currently running 245/30/20, 285/25/20 Vredestein Ultrac Sessenta tires. Ride is nice with these tires so far.
